I have a name, I really do. I was born with this name. It is Rebecca and not sweetie, babe, baby, or hot stuff. Respect for who I am is shown by using my name. You come on to me or try to pick me up by saying Hey Baby and I think, I just another person you are trying to win over. If you really, truly interested. I would hear, Hello Rebecca. I am?, How are you and can I please get to know you. This shows me I have some value and importance to whom I will be speaking to.

I agree with you Rebecca...I am wondering why men use such terms of endearment like baby, dear, darling, honey casually to women they hardly knew. I believe that these words must be use only to address someone you are familiar with and care about. Its more appropriate to call women by their first names specially when you are in that getting to know stage.
